Order of the Phoenix DVD
Order Harry Potter and the Order of the Phoenix at Amazon.com:
Blu-ray DVD |
HD DVD
Release Date: November 12 (UK) and December 11 (US)
Prices:
- Two-disc Special Edition: $34.99
- Single-disc Widescreen: $28.98
- Single-disc Full Screen: $28.98
- HD DVD: $35.99
- Blu-ray DVD: $35.99
Features (Two-disc Special Edition):
- Additional Scenes: 17 minutes of never-before-seen footage.
- Trailing Tonks - Spend a day with Actress Nat Tena and receive a very personal and often wacky tour of the Harry Potter and The Order of the Phoenix stages.
- Harry Potter: The Magic of Editing - Director David Yates and Editor Mark Day show what a difference a good edit makes to allow the viewers to edit a scene.
- A&E Documentary: The Hidden Secrets of Harry Potter - Viewers take a thrilling look back at the past Harry Potter films in search of clues to the mysteries of the upcoming Harry Potter saga.
- ROM - This will include a timeline, a link to sneaks of HP6, along with other materials.
